The Battle Between Light and the Paralysis Demon

Days collapsed.

Sleep vanished.

I forbade my eyes

to close,

afraid of the shadows

waiting inside.

One mistake,

one step outside the line—

and I cracked.

A night alone,

at the table—

I shut my eyes,

barely a moment

and It was there.

I fled to my room.

Bare walls.

No light.

No sign if life.

Just-

a mattress in the corner.

I made myself small.

My dog stood guard,

growling at nothing.

But it was not nothing.

She cast a glow,

Patronus Charm

white and fierce.

A shield.

It yielded to her command.

Dawn broke.

I was safe,

another day.
